Photographer’s Note
A drive deep in the heart of Dumfriesshire with the rain threatening. This is a one track road between Ae village and Durisdeer village. We took a route over moorland that was desolate and wild. For some miles there was only sheep for company and they were skittish, not wanting to stay to be included in a photograph.
